Vue.js环境变量:智能配置,轻松适应各种开发场景
发表时间: 2024-03-08 09:26
概述:Vue.js环境变量的巧妙运用使得不同环境下的配置管理变得轻松。通过创建.env文件,结合Vue组件和Vue CLI配置,你可以在开发、测试和生产环境中智能地管理API地址和其他配置,提高项目的灵活性和可维护性
在Vue.js中,使用环境变量可以方便地管理不同环境下的配置信息。以下是通过实例详细说明如何使用环境变量。
在项目根目录下创建.env文件,可以创建多个不同环境的文件,如.env.development、.env.production等。
# .envVUE_APP_API_URL=https://api.example.com
<!-- 使用环境变量 --><template> <div> <p>API地址: {{ apiUrl }}</p> </div></template><script>export default { data() { return { apiUrl: process.env.VUE_APP_API_URL }; }};</script>
确保你的vue.config.js配置文件中允许了环境变量的读取。
// vue.config.jsmodule.exports = { // ... configureWebpack: { // ... }, // ...};
以上实例中,VUE_APP_API_URL是一个环境变量,通过process.env来访问。在不同环境下,Vue会根据环境文件自动切换对应的变量值,使得开发、测试和生产环境的配置轻松管理。
这样,你可以在不同环境中设置不同的API地址、密钥等信息,而不用修改代码。 确保在使用环境变量时,遵循Vue CLI的规定以及环境变量的安全性考虑。